Abstract

The utility model discloses a door frame main lock adjustable lock box which comprises a fixed box and a lock box body, the fixed box is arranged on a door frame, the lock box body is installed on the fixed box through a connecting assembly, the lock box body comprises a cylindrical lock body, and the lock body is provided with an eccentric lock hole in the axial direction. The connecting assembly is coaxially arranged at the bottom of the lock box body, the lock box body can rotate around the axis of the lock box body, and the lock box body can be fixed through the connecting assembly after rotating. The position of the lock hole of the lock box body can be adjusted, when a gap between a door leaf and a door frame is uneven and the door leaf shakes when closed, the position of the lock box body can be adjusted to ensure that the lock hole corresponds to a spring bolt, and then the lock body can be used.

Description

Technical Field

[0001] This utility model relates to the technical field of door leaf main lock tongue fixing structure, and in particular to an adjustable lock box for door frame main lock. Background Technology

[0002] Currently, most standard main lock bolts on the market are fixed with stainless steel decorative panels. When there is an uneven gap between the door leaf and the door frame, or when the door leaf shakes when closed, the stainless steel decorative panel cannot be fixed to adjust the gap between the door leaf and the bolt to fit the bolt, which in turn prevents the bolt from entering the stainless steel decorative panel. Utility Model Content

[0003] The purpose of this utility model is to overcome the shortcomings of the prior art and provide an adjustable lock box for the main lock of the door frame. The position of the lock eye is adjustable. When there is unevenness between the door leaf and the door frame or when the door leaf shakes when closed, the position of the lock box body can be adjusted to ensure that the lock eye and the lock tongue correspond, thereby ensuring that the lock body can be used.

[0025] Example:

[0026] like Figures 1-5As shown, an adjustable lock box for a door frame main lock includes a fixed box 1 and a lock box body 2. The fixed box 1 is disposed on the door frame 3, and the lock box body 2 is mounted on the fixed box 1 through a connecting component 6. The lock box body 2 includes a cylindrical lock body 4, and the lock body 4 has an eccentric keyhole 5 along the axial direction.

[0027] The connecting component 6 is coaxially disposed at the bottom of the lock box body 2. The lock box body 2 can rotate around its axis, and the lock box body 2 can be fixed by the connecting component 6 after rotation.

[0028] The fixing box 1 is a rectangular box structure with one end open. The door frame 3 is provided with a clearance hole corresponding to the opening position of the fixing box 1. The lock box body 2 extends into the fixing box 1 through the clearance hole and the opening of the fixing box 1.

[0029] The fixing box 1 is provided with a stiffening plate 11, which is fixed to the door frame 3.

[0030] The stiffening plate 11 is welded and fixed to the door frame 3.

[0031] like Figure 4 As shown, the lock box body 2 has a U-shaped cross-section. (In this way, the keyhole 5 does not pass through the lock box body 2, thus ensuring that the lock box body 2 can be connected to the fixing box 1 through its bottom surface and connecting component 6).

[0032] like Figure 4 As shown, the connecting component 6 includes a bolt 10 and a nut 9. The nut 9 is fixed to the bottom of the fixing box 1, and the axis of the nut 9 coincides with the axis of the fixing box 1. The fixing box 1 and the locking box body 2 are respectively provided with through holes coaxial with the nut 9.

[0033] The bolt 10 is connected to the nut 9 through a through hole.

[0034] The bottom of the lock box body 2 is provided with a countersunk hole 7, and the head of the bolt 10 is located in the countersunk hole 7. The end face of the head of the bolt 10 is flush with the inner bottom surface of the lock box body 2.

[0035] The lock box body 2 has a coaxial retaining ring 8 on its end face, and the inner diameter of the retaining ring 8 is larger than the diameter of the clearance hole.

[0036] Among them, 1. The inner diameter of the fixed box 1 is matched with the outer diameter of the lock box body 2, which in turn ensures that the lock box body 2 rotates only around the axis of the lock box body 2 when it rotates.

[0037] Working principle: As shown in the diagram, the keyhole 5 is located near the right side of the door frame 3. When there is a gap in the door leaf, first tighten the bolt 10 (until it disengages from the nut 9). At this time, the lock box body 2 can rotate relative to its axis. The lock box body 2 can then be adjusted according to the position of the door leaf latch. When adjusted to correspond with the position of the latch, the lock box body 2 is fixed to the nut 9 by the bolt 10, ensuring that the position of the lock box body 2 is fixed and the keyhole 5 corresponds to the position of the latch.
